Abstract

Purpose. To define the methodological approaches and directions for developing research competencies in students of full-time general higher education programs.

Methods. Theoretical analysis.

Findings. Directions of the formation of research competencies among students of full-time general higher education programs are proposed. It is demonstrated that the implementation of these directions requires a comprehensive approach, including the integration of scientific research into the educational process, the establishment of a mentoring system, the stimulation of both students and teaching staff, and the development of academic mobility programs. These measures can significantly enhance the level of research competencies among students and prepare them for successful professional activities. It is established that an educational process incorporating elements of research activity allows students not only to deepen their knowledge in a specific field but also to develop skills in systemic thinking, analytical and critical analysis, as well as the ability to work with information and new technologies. Through participation in research activities, students not only cultivate their reasoning, justification, and argumentation skills but also enhance their ability to publicly present and defend the results of their work. Furthermore, they recognize themselves as subjects of the research process, acquiring skills in solving research-related challenges.

Application field of research. The educational process of full-time general higher education programs.
